Column Type = Text
This column defines what is entered in the Value column.
Inflow - Hourly energy inflows into the reservoir. Units = MWh
Initial Content - Content at the start of the study. If entered as a time series, the value in effect at start of study will be used. Units = MWh
Max Content - Maximum reservoir content. Units = MWh
Min Content - Minimum reservoir content. Reservoir can only be drawn below this level for losses or to meet spill requirements. Units = MWh
Min Spill - Hourly bypass spill released from the reservoir with no associated generation. The project will draft below the minimum content to meet this requirement. Units = MWh
Min Flow - Hourly minimum total release required from the reservoir. If this value is present, the spill will contribute to the total and can reduce a minimum generation constraint. Units = MWh
Loss Rate - Fraction of contents lost each hour due to factors such as leakage, evaporation, or other withdrawals. Range is 0 to 1.0.
Report - A value of TRUE will activate hourly reporting for the operation of the reservoir and will create the CompositeReservoirDetail output table.
Price Function - These records express the dispatch price of reservoir energy as a function of content. For any given dispatch hour, the content/price pairs must increase in price with decreasing content, i.e. energy is more expensive with increasing draft of the reservoir. For two adjacent curves, the price at the lower content applies to all available energy in between the two. There is no limit to the number of function entries, but it is recommended that a curve at zero always be defined. If the low content curve in any given time period is above zero, energy between that point and minimum content will not be available to the dispatch, but will be used to meet any spill targets.
